Higher temperatures reduce the performance of an aircraft’s engines and the lift that it needs to take off. Read more at straitstimes.com.

SINGAPORE – Passengers on board at least two Scoot flights from Athens to Singapore had to fly without their baggage after the heatwave engulfing Greece affected aircraft performance.

She said Scoot has since reached out to affected customers to arrange for their baggage to be sent to their homes or hotels. “Scoot sincerely apologises for the inconvenience caused. The safety of our customers and crew is our top priority, and we will continue to provide our customers with the necessary assistance required,” its spokesman added.

A Twitter user, who said he flew from Athens on Saturday, complained that his flight was delayed by two hours and that passengers were not told that their checked luggage was removed from the plane before take-off.More On This TopicAnother Scoot passenger, who flew from Athens to Singapore on July 20, told ST that she also had no idea that her checked bags were taken off the plane before departure.

A woman cools off with cold bottles of water near the entrance of the Acropolis in Athens on July 20, 2023. Greece has been experiencing record heat, with temperatures exceeding 40 deg C. PHOTO: AFP The passenger said: “I appreciate it was chaos on the ground, but the whole response from the Scoot and Sats call centres was terrible. I phoned Scoot about four or five times, and I phoned Sats, I reckon, about 30 times. They had no idea what was going on.”
